Function and Role of the Damper Assembly in GE Washer Suspension and Vibration Control
The WH01X10727 GE Washer Damper Assembly is a shock-absorbing component that controls the vertical motion and transient response of the wash tub during agitation and high-speed spin. Functionally it converts kinetic energy from tub movement into heat through damping elements (fluid, elastomer, or friction interfaces depending on design), reducing amplitude of oscillation and the forces transmitted to the cabinet and floor. In operation it works in concert with the suspension springs and mounting hardware: springs set the static ride height and natural frequency,while the damper provides velocity-dependent resistance that prevents the system from ringing or resonating when an unbalanced load occurs (for example,a single heavy load of towels shifted to one side during spin). Correct part selection and orientation matter because the damper’s stiffness and damping coefficient are tuned to the machine’s mass and spring rates; replacing a worn damper with a mismatched unit can alter ride quality or lead to persistent vibration issues.
- Primary functions: absorb shock, limit tub rebound, and dissipate kinetic energy during spin cycles.
- common failure symptoms: loud banging or knocking, excessive vertical bounce, persistent wobble at spin speed, or visible fluid/boot deterioration.
- Installation notes: secure fasteners, confirm orientation, and inspect companion suspension components (springs, mounts) for concurrent wear.

From a practical service perspective,diagnosing damper issues requires isolating them from other suspension faults: loose or broken springs,misleveled feet,and bearing problems can produce similar symptoms. A technician should first level the appliance and test with a known balanced load; if excessive transient motion remains and the mounting hardware shows wear or movement, replacing the damper and any worn isolators restores the designed damping characteristics. After replacement, validate performance by running diagnostics or a full-spin cycle and confirming the tub returns to steady state without prolonged oscillation-if excessive motion persists, check spring stiffness and chassis integrity before assuming a second damper failure.

Common failure Symptoms, Diagnostic Indicators, and Wear Patterns of the Damper Assembly
The WH01X10727 GE Washer Damper Assembly is a dampening module that controls vertical movement of the inner tub by converting kinetic energy into controlled friction through rubber bushings and a metal housing. installed between the tub and the chassis or suspension rods, the damper attenuates shocks from unbalanced loads and isolates vibration from the cabinet; improper fitment, reversed orientation, or mismatched replacement parts will degrade performance and can transmit excess load to bearings and suspension components. Technicians should verify model compatibility and correct mounting torque when installing the unit to restore the original dynamic response of the washer.
- Loud banging or rhythmic thumping during the spin cycle
- Excessive side-to-side tub movement or rocking at spin speed
- Visible oil/grease contamination,torn or compressed rubber bushings
- Asymmetric tub position or sagging on one side when unloaded
Diagnostic indicators for damper failure include increased free play when the tub is manually displaced,metal-to-metal contact noise under load,and progressive degradation of ride quality that accelerates bearing wear; these symptoms correlate to wear patterns such as flattened or delaminated bushings,elongated mounting holes,and surface scoring on the damper piston or housing. Practical inspection steps are: apply a vertical displacement to the tub and observe rebound behavior, run a short spin with a centered test load to isolate imbalance, and visually inspect the damper for torn elastomer or lubricant leakage; if these checks show mechanical damage or excessive play, replacement with the correct part is the appropriate corrective action to prevent downstream failures.

Replacement considerations and Step‑by‑step Installation Procedure for Damper Assembly Mounts and Fasteners
The WH01X10727 GE Washer Damper Assembly functions as the mechanical interface between the inner tub and the cabinet, absorbing vertical and radial movement to prevent impact loads from transmitting through the chassis during agitation and high-speed spin.Damper behavior changes as rubber isolators and mounting bushings wear: common symptoms include metallic clunks at start/stop, pronounced tub travel, or asymmetric vibration. Confirm compatibility by checking the replacement damper’s flange hole spacing, pin diameter, and overall length against the machine’s service diagram; mismatched geometry or incorrect bushing diameters can change the suspension frequency and create binding or rapid wear of adjacent components. For safety and to avoid distortion of the suspension, disconnect power and support the tub before removing any fasteners.
- Remove top and/or rear access panels to reach damper mounts, then support the tub with a jack or straps and record original damper orientation and fastener locations.
- Back out mounting hardware and remove the old damper assembly; inspect studs, mounting brackets, and rubber bushings for corrosion or elongation.
- Fit the replacement damper, aligning pins and isolators to the original orientation; use OEM or equivalent-grade fasteners and replace any damaged washers or lock hardware.
- Hand-start all fasteners to ensure correct fit, then tighten uniformly to the manufacturer’s torque specification (refer to the service manual). Use a medium-strength threadlocker only if the original installation used one.
- Reassemble panels, remove tub supports, and run a diagnostic/spin cycle with a small load to verify elimination of noise and that tub travel is within normal range.

Practical tips: avoid overtightening isolator seating bolts because compressing the rubber changes damping characteristics and shortens service life; if fasteners are seized, apply penetrating oil and use controlled heat rather than excessive torque to prevent stud damage.After installation, verify that there is no metal-to-metal contact at the mount points and that vibration levels return to the expected range during both low-speed agitation and high-speed spin cycles.

How can I test a damper to see if WH01X10727 needs replacing?
With the washer unplugged, support the tub and manually lift, push, or pull the drum-if the tub falls back or slams rather than returning smoothly and being damped, a damper is likely worn. Visually inspect the damper for torn rubber boots, oil leakage, broken mounts, or excessive play at the mounting points. For a more definitive test, remove the damper and check that it provides smooth resistance when compressed and extended; a damper that moves freely without resistance is bad.

should I replace only the damaged damper or all of them at once?
It is often recommended to replace all dampers at the same time if the washer is older or other dampers show signs of wear, because they tend to wear out together and replacing only one may lead to uneven damping and uneven wear. If the washer is relatively new and only one damper is damaged, replacing just the bad one is acceptable-but monitor the others for wear.
